Caledon Farmer's Market

So I got to the Farmer's Market..
Bert indeed did still have Lamb Spiedini - $1 each.  I got 25 - good for tomorrow night' s barbecue with the neighbours!

Biscotti Shoppe was there and I got 4 lemoncello biscotti - perfect for my tea!  They are organic and made with spelt flour - so I can finally enjoy! www.thebiscottishoppe.ca/  I have to say - the very best.

I wandered and saw the most gorgeous items, stained glass - but in plates... absolutely stunning... but I had my budget - ( I can catch that later perhaps! - as long as Ian doesn't find out!)

There was a lovely woman selling organic produce, onions, large zucchini  (ZUCCHINI BREAD!)(****will make a post just for that) and the most massive kale... (YES I BOUGHT KALE.... the boys will kill me!)   However it is for the guests tomorrow - Kale chips...

Got the Lamb, wandered still to the other side, discovered a lovely woman selling mushrooms - what a selection!  Got them in a small quantity as my son Jordan hates mushrooms - but he has learned to eat them on the rare occasions that I make them. 

On to the pastry and tart man - they were to die for - who ever sees 3 KINDS OF BUTTER TARTS?  I have a dear friend who lives in Minnesota - and whenever he comes to Canada - one of the first things he looks for are butter tarts!  YOU CAN'T BUY THEM IN THE U.S.!!  When he comes up next year - I will get him a nice little supply.....  I bought 2 for my boys - but I alas I can't eat them as they are wheat.  I asked if they ever considered spelt... this delightful man - said he could look into it!  Imagine butter tarts that I can eat?  Tarts period that I could eat - I DOOOOO miss them.
